VW plans to unveil their new 550-hp 5.5L V-12 TDI-powered Touareg Trophy Truck at the Los Angeles Auto Show next week.The vehicle is slated to leave the show on the 21st and head straight to Ensanada, Baja Mexico to arrive just prior to the start of the 41st annual Tecate SCORE Baja 1000 off-road race.
Driver and chassis design/production manager Ryan Arciero and Mark Miller feel confident that the vehicle is quite capable of finishing the race right out of the box. Placing in the top 3 however is not expected as this race program is still in it's infancy. The Race Touareg TDI Trophy Truck features a wheelbase of 125 inches, overall length of 213 inches, width of 92 inches, an overall height of 78 inches and weighs 5,650 pounds- light by Trophy truck standards. The Race Touareg TDI Trophy Truck Body was designed by the Volkswagen Design Center located in Santa Monica, California.
